Alleviating Your Dog's Uncomfortable Skin: Sensitivity Easing Guidance

Is your precious friend constantly scratching, biting their skin? It could be reactions! Finding the root of the problem is key, but in the meantime, you can give some immediate soothing. Try these easy approaches:

  • Change to a sensitive shampoo – look for fragrance-free formulas.
  • Add fish oil supplements to their food to support healthy skin.
  • Frequent baths with lukewarm water can aid remove triggers.
  • Consider putting on a gentle soothing spray or balm.
Remember, a checkup to your vet is necessary to identify the precise cause and plan a ongoing treatment plan.

Skin Remedies for Dog Fur Allergies: What Works?

Dealing with the itchy dog due to fur allergies can be challenging. Fortunately, various topical treatments can alleviate discomfort. Effective options include cleansing baths containing substances like hydrocortisone to soothe irritation. Creams with like properties, sometimes including natural extracts such as aloe vera, can decrease redness. However to carefully consult with your animal doctor before introducing new products to your dog's skin, as some ingredients can cause adverse reactions in sensitive animals. In addition, keep in mind that topical treatments are often most effective when used alongside addressing the root cause.

Preventing Dog Skin Sensitivities: Sustainable Strategies

Dealing with Fido’s skin sensitivities often requires a long-lasting approach, beyond just treating immediate flare-ups. Implementing enduring solutions involves identifying the root cause—which can be seasonal . Consider routine skin testing by a veterinarian to determine specific triggers . Beyond that, focus on establishing a hygienic living environment by often vacuuming floors and upholstery . Regular bathing with a gentle shampoo can also help, but be sure to ask your vet about the intervals to avoid drying the skin . Finally, mindful dietary management, potentially including a hypoallergenic food, is a essential component in controlling future sensitivity problems .
